The analysis of 95 data center articles dated August 18, 2026, identified locality issues in 62.1% of cases, underscoring ongoing challenges in the sector. Government policy emerged as the predominant concern, accounting for 31 instances, followed by community pushback and power grid or energy issues. Geographically, while locality challenges were noted generally in 10 reports, specific states of Wisconsin, Texas, Illinois, and North Carolina showed notable activity, with Wisconsin and Texas each reporting four issues. These patterns highlight the continuing impact of regulatory and community factors on data center development across key regions.
